What is a Yoga Studio Franchise?

A yoga studio franchise is a business owned and operated by an individual franchisee but follows the business model, branding, and guidelines of the franchisor. Franchises are popular in many industries, including the yoga industry, as they offer entrepreneurs the opportunity to start their own business with the support of an established brand.

 

The Requirements of Starting a Yoga Studio Franchise

However, starting a franchise has a few requirements that you need to meet before you can even begin the process.

  • Liquid Capital: To start a yoga studio franchise, you’ll need access to liquid capital, which is money that can be easily converted into cash. This is important because most franchisors require an upfront investment – also known as a franchise fee – ranging from $10,000 to $100,000. In addition to the franchise fee, you’ll also need to have enough money saved to cover the costs of renting or purchasing a yoga studio space and hiring yoga instructors and other staff.
  • Good Credit Score: You’ll also need a good credit score to be approved for a yoga studio franchise. This is because most franchisors will require you to take out a small business loan to cover the upfront franchise fee and other costs associated with starting your yoga studio.
  • Business Acumen: Finally, you’ll need basic business knowledge and experience to run a successful yoga studio franchise. This includes understanding how to manage finances, market your yoga studio, and hire and train yoga instructors.

The Costs of Starting a Yoga Studio Franchise

As mentioned earlier, you need a lot of capital to start a yoga studio franchise. That’s because many startup costs and fees are associated with franchises, including the franchise fee, which we’ll cover in more detail below.

  • Franchise Fee: The franchise fee is the most significant cost to consider when starting a yoga studio franchise, as it ranges anywhere from $10,000 to $100,000. This upfront fee gives you the right to use the franchisor’s name, logo, and business model.
  • Royalty Fees: In addition to the franchise fee, you’ll also be responsible for paying ongoing royalty fees to the franchisor. These fees are typically a percentage of your yoga studio’s monthly or annual revenue and are used to cover the costs of providing you with support, marketing, and other resources.
  • Studio Space: In addition to the franchise fee, you’ll also need to factor in the cost of renting or purchasing a yoga studio space. The price of studio space will vary depending on the location and size of the yoga studio, but it’s important to factor in this cost when determining if you can afford to start a yoga studio franchise.
  • Instructors and Staff: You’ll also need to hire yoga instructors and other staff members to help run your yoga studio. The cost of hiring staff will vary depending on the number of instructors and staff members you need, their experience, and qualifications.
  • Marketing and Advertising: You’ll need to budget for marketing and advertising expenses to help promote your yoga studio. The cost of marketing and advertising will vary depending on the type of marketing and advertising you do. Still, it’s important to factor this cost into your overall budget for starting a yoga studio franchise.

 

The Pros of Opening a Yoga Studio Franchise

Many advantages come with opening a yoga studio franchise, such as:

  1. Brand Recognition: One of the biggest advantages of running a yoga studio franchise is that you’ll have instant brand recognition. This is because people are already familiar with the franchisor’s name and logo, which makes it easier to attract customers.
  2. Support and Resources: Another advantage of running a yoga studio franchise is that you’ll have access to support and resources from the franchisor. This includes things like marketing resources, training materials, and operational support.
  3. Turnkey Business Model: A yoga studio franchise is also a turnkey business model, which means everything is already set up for you. This includes the yoga studio space, the instructors, the staff, and the marketing and advertising. So all you need to do is open the doors and start running the yoga studio!
  4. Proven Business Model: Finally, a yoga studio franchise comes with a proven business model. This means that the franchisor has already been successful in running yoga studios and they know what it takes to be successful.

 

The Cons of Opening a Yoga Studio Franchise

While there are many advantages to running a yoga studio franchise, there are also some disadvantages that you should be aware of, such as:

  1. High Initial Investment: The biggest disadvantage of running a yoga studio franchise is the high initial investment. This includes the franchise fee, the costs of renting or purchasing a yoga studio space, the costs of hiring instructors and staff, and the costs of marketing and advertising.
  2. Ongoing Fees: In addition to the high initial investment, you’ll also be responsible for paying ongoing fees to the franchisor. These fees include things like royalty fees, marketing fees, and other support fees.
  3. Limited Autonomy: Another disadvantage of running a yoga studio franchise is that you’ll have limited autonomy in running the yoga studio. You’ll need to follow the franchisor’s guidelines and procedures in running the yoga studio, which can be restrictive for some entrepreneurs.
  4. Limited Creativity: Finally, a yoga studio franchise offers less scope for creativity than an independent yoga studio. This is because you’ll need to follow the franchisor’s guidelines and procedures in running the yoga studio, which can limit your ability to be creative in how you run the yoga studio.

 

Yoga Studio Franchise Opportunities to Check Out

If you’re interested in running a yoga studio franchise, you may consider the following top yoga franchises: 

  1. CorePower Yoga: CorePower Yoga is a national yoga franchisor that offers yoga studio franchise opportunities. They offer a turnkey business model and provide support and resources to franchisees. It costs $150,000 to open a CorePower Yoga franchise and you need a liquid capital of $75,000.
  2. YogaFit: YogaFit is a yoga franchisor that offers yoga studio franchise opportunities. They provide support and resources to franchisees, and their model is designed to be scalable. It costs $30,000 to open a YogaFit franchise, and you need liquid capital of $10,000.
  3. Real Hot Yoga: Real Hot Yoga is a yoga franchisor that offers yoga studio franchise opportunities. They provide support and resources to franchisees, and their franchise model is designed to be scalable. It costs $20,000 to open a Real Hot Yoga franchise and you need liquid capital of $10,000.
  4. Honor Yoga: Honor Yoga is a yoga franchisor that offers yoga studio franchise opportunities. They provide support and resources to franchisees, and their franchise model is designed to be scalable. It costs $40,000 to open an Honor Yoga franchise, and you need liquid capital of $20,000.
